Python - INHABILITAR / HABILITAR BOTON

 
Vista:
sin imagen de perfil

INHABILITAR / HABILITAR BOTON

Publicado por JJ (2 intervenciones) el 28/07/2020 04:19:04
Buenas noches

quien me pueda ayudar tengo un combobox que me trae unos valores de la base de datos y necesito que si el combobox no se toca los botones esten inhabilitados y al mover un valor del combobox se habiliten para su uso

este es el codigo que tengo

1
2
3
4
5
6
7
8
9
10
11
12
13
@QtCore.pyqtSlot()
    def llenar_comboBox_tDoc(self):
        db = pymysql.connect('localhost', 'root','root','basededatos')
        cursor = db.cursor()
        cursor.execute("SELECT documento FROM tabla")
        lista = cursor.fetchall()
        self.combobox.clear()
 
        self.combobox.addItems([str(x[0]) for x in lista])
 
        db.commit()
 
        db.close()
con este codigo me trae la informacion de la base de datos

y estos son los botones que debo inhabilitar hasta que no se mueva el combobox

1
2
3
4
self.llenar_comboBox_tDoc() # se llama el metodo y trae la informacion al combobox
 
self.boton1.setEnabled(False) # inhabilita el boton
self.boton1.setEnabled(True) # habilitar el boton

en esta parte es donde necesito el condicional
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der